Different mounts have a different "feel" to them; for example, a panther is much bouncier than a broomstick, and steering a Malorian dragon feels like I'm driving an SUV. Currently the only way to find out how a mount handles before buying is to rent it, but for crowns-only mounts that costs crowns, too, and it's not a token amount.

What I would like to see is a "test drive" option in the crown shop for crowns-only mounts. It would work in much the same way castle previews work: clicking on the magnifying glass icon would take you to a test drive range where you could practice navigating the mount around an obstacle course and find out before buying if you like the way it handles.
